Long-time The Young and the Restless fans are in for a special treat this holiday season as Michael Damian returns to the soap as Danny Romalotti after almost 10 years! In addition to sharing scenes with his ex-wife Phyllis (Michelle Stafford) and son Daniel (Michael Graziadei), look for Michael to reunite onscreen with two of his leading ladies from the ‘80s – Tracey E. Bregman (Lauren) and Beth Maitland (Traci).

The TV Watercooler was fortunate to speak with Michael, Tracey, and Beth to get a preview of their reunion, the high ‘80s hair, and the wishes their characters may have for the New Year.

The fans are definitely looking forward to it. Michael, it’s been almost 10 years since Danny was on the show for Katherine Chancellor’s memorial service. How did this return come about?

The show reached out to me and said that it’s their big 50 and that they were bringing back my son Daniel [played by Michael Graziadei] and wanted to know if I was available to come back to Genoa City and have some fun – do some episodes with Beth Maitland (Traci), Tracey Bregman (Lauren), Michael Graziadei (Daniel), Michelle Stafford (Phyllis), and Christian LeBlanc (Michael), and who could say “no” to that?

It was perfect timing, and I was really excited about not just coming back but I really enjoyed the scripts that they sent. I thought the dialogue was excellent.

Michael: Yes! I also remember that my hair couldn’t fit into the set. It stuck out over the edge of the set!

Tracey: Yeah, we needed the entire set for our hair.

Michael: That’s when Bill Bell called me up to his office and said, “Michael, could you please do me a favour?” “Yeah, what is it, Mr. Bell?” I replied. “Could you just get a haircut?” I was like “Oh, is it too long?” And he said, “Yeah when you’re doing scenes with Traci and Lauren, you guys can’t even fit into a close-up because the hair is so big!” I was like, “Why don’t the girls cut their hair?”
